Cost of Assisted Living in Meridian Township, MI

It’s crucial to comprehend what determines the cost of care in a Meridian Township, MI assisted living facility. The largest fee is the residence. Is it okay to share a two-bedroom unit, or is a private bedroom, bath, and kitchen needed? What amount of care will the occupant need? Will this level of care be enough for the near future, or will additional care be needed?

  • Assisted Living Meridian Township Low: $2,205.00
  • Assisted Living Meridian Township Average: $3,635.00
  • Assisted Living Meridian Township High: $5,125.00
  • Michigan Average: $3,618.00
  • National Average: $4,000.00

Reservation Deposit

Most assisted living facilities in Meridian Township will charge future residents a reservation deposit. Deposits can be a couple thousand dollars and it saves the accommodations that you select for a while, usually a few months. It is occasionally referred to as a “community fee”. Usually, this fee does not apply to any other charges and is sometimes refundable only if the would-be occupant is unable to move into the facility for health reasons.

Base Fee

The base fee covers the monthly rent for an assisted living suite. In Meridian Township the fees are determined by the size of the residential unit and if it’s private or 2 bedroom. Most base fees include basic housekeeping, utilities, maintenance, and some meals. The base rate is also based on the kind of care you need, like independent living, assisted living, or memory care.

Care Services Fee

The cost by and large uses a multi-level approach determined by the level of care you need and it gets included in the monthly rate. The degree of assistance is mostly based on the number of activities of daily living for which a resident requires regular assistance. Activities of Daily Living involves dining, dressing, toileting, grooming, etc. The scheduled price of caring services in Meridian Township, MI varies from $150 or so for level one and could go up to a few thousand dollars per month for level five assisted living caring. Accurately figuring the degree of care needed is one of the most important aspects of the decision process and also one of the more difficult to understand. The more thorough, medical, and intensive the assessment, the better the plan of care and grasping of the cost.

Other Fees

A lot of residents of assisted living facilities need assistance remembering to take medicines at the correct time and in the right dosage. Many assisted living communities accommodate prescription drug observance services for a separate charge. It’s normally several hundred dollars a month, conditional to how complicated the medicine administration is. If it’s wanted, supplementary support services like occupational or physical therapy can also be billed on a monthly basis. Non-care affiliated services, probably including parking, special meals, and some activities as well.
